Computer Controlled Optical Surfacing
Aspheres & precision sphere, flats, cylinders
Can achieve: ›› 1 nm RMS surface figure, ›› 0.2 nm RMS surface roughness (glass)
Configurable for glass, CaF2, Zerodur, ULE, SiC, Si, other materials and a wide range of part geometries
Scalable for optics beyond 1.5 meters
Employs proprietary Computer Controlled Optical Surfacing (CCOS) technology
